How far is Santa Cruz from Tarija?

The distance between Tarija (Capitán Oriel Lea Plaza Airport) and Santa Cruz (Viru Viru International Airport) is 288 miles / 463 kilometers / 250 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Tarija (TJA) to Santa Cruz (VVI) is 420 miles / 676 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 10 hours 56 minutes.

Distance from Tarija to Santa Cruz

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Tarija to Santa Cruz.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 287.719 miles
  • 463.039 kilometers
  • 250.021 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 288.791 miles
  • 464.765 kilometers
  • 250.953 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).

How long does it take to fly from Tarija to Santa Cruz?

The estimated flight time from Capitán Oriel Lea Plaza Airport to Viru Viru International Airport is 1 hour and 2 minutes.

What is the time difference between Tarija and Santa Cruz?

There is no time difference between Tarija and Santa Cruz.

Flight carbon footprint between Capitán Oriel Lea Plaza Airport (TJA) and Viru Viru International Airport (VVI)

On average, flying from Tarija to Santa Cruz generates about 67 kg of CO2 per passenger, and 67 kilograms equals 149 pounds (lbs). The figures are estimates and include only the CO2 generated by burning jet fuel.
